Notes  Diet: photosynthetic [details]

Dimensions: up to 15 cm high [details]

Distribution: Long Island sound, Gulf of Maine to Strait of Belle Isle [details]

Habitat: Known from rocky shores. [details]

Morphology: Green colour from Chlorophyll a and b. [details]

Reproduction: general for group: asexual reproduction may be by fission (splitting), fragmentation or by zoospores (motile spores). Sexual reproduction may be isogamous (gametes both motile and same size); anisogamous (both motile and different sizes-female bigger) or oogamous (female non-motile and egglike; male motile) [details]
